Entire Restored 10 bedroom Hotel! Located on 62 acre resort
Make some memories at this unique and family-friendly place. The former Hotel is located in the Sycamore Springs Whitetail Ranch Resort. There are 62 acres to explore while staying, try out the largest wooden floor roller skating rink in Kansas or a round on the 18 hole mini golf course. We have a splash pad, hiking trails, fishing pond, horseshoe pits, tennis/pickle ball courts, playground, creek to explore, museum, 200 yrs of history and lots of fresh air!! We are located in the middle of "nowhere" no highway noise just the birds and the brook. 6 queen beds and 6 full beds sleeps 24 *The skating rink, mini-golf & splash pad are an additional cost of $7/day/person. *Multi-day discounts available and 5 & under are free.
We also have the adjoining guest house that sleep an additional 16-20 people it has 5 bedrooms a full kitchen and handicap accessible shower email or message us for additional information and prices to add the house to your stay. Combined if you book both properties you can sleep 50 people. We also have RV hookups to add additional options for you.

Why they chose this property
Indian folklore dating from early 1800's and earlier, relate many interesting facts of early Sycamore Springs history. Many Indian Tribes were known to use the mineral water for healing purposes. Early Indians used airtight wigwarms and mineral water poured over hot rocks for sweat baths.
By the early 1800's many settlers were moving westward and one of their important water stops was Sycamore Springs. John Brown and James Lane, early Kansas Free Staters, spent time in the area. The Springs known then as Plymouth Springs was one of several towns organized by Lane. A fort, built by James Lane, was located nearby.
By 1880, the mineral water and beautiful picnic areas were becoming well known and a large 60-room wood framed hotel building was built. Sycamore Springs, by 1886, had become widely known as an outstanding health resort of the Midwest. A five story stone hotel was also built which contained all the latest conveniences and modern hospital facilities. Both buildings were destroyed by fire in 1916. The present hotel was rebuilt using the stone walls left from the fire in the early 1920's.
Besides the hotel and hospital facilities, Sycamore Springs once had a post office, general store, barber shop and pop bottling plant.
